Manage Alerts | What Is This? SWAKOPMUND, Namibia (AP) -- Angelina Jolie and Brad Pitt on Wednesday thanked Namibia for the privacy and peace they enjoyed for the birth of their daughter.
"We have been able to have a very special, peaceful time for our family here, exploring your country and, more importantly, helping with the delivery of our daughter, Shiloh," Pitt told a news conference for local journalists at the Hansa hotel in the coastal town of Swakopmund. "So for that we are eternally grateful."
It was the movie star couple's first public appearance since Shiloh Nouvel Jolie-Pitt was born May 27 at a private clinic in Walvis Bay.
Delivered by Caesarean section, the baby weighed 7 pounds (3.15 kilograms) and was said to be in good health.
She was not present at the news conference.
Pitt and Jolie retreated to the southwest African country for government-assisted privacy in the weeks leading up to the birth.
Jolie, relaxed and smiling in a long black dress, said the couple had sought a place where they could spend some special time with her two adopted children, 16-month-old Zahara, from Ethiopia, and 4-year-old Maddox, from Cambodia.
"We both had traveled to Africa and loved this part of the world," said Jolie, 30.
The couple plans to leave in the next few days, they said, without specifying a date.
Both Jolie's adopted children had their surnames legally changed to Jolie-Pitt after Pitt announced his intentions to adopt the children as well.
Pitt, 42, and Jennifer Aniston divorced last year.
